    Gulshan Grover (born 21 September 1955) is an Indian actor and film producer who has appeared in over 100 films. [ 2 ] [ 3 ] He is popularly known as the " Bad Man " [ 4 ] of Hindi cinema because of his ability to create an impact with his negative roles in films.

    Vaapsi (Return) is an Indian Punjabi language drama film directed by Rakesh Mehta and starring Harish Verma, Sameksha, Dhrriti Saharan and Gulshan Grover as the main protagonists of the film. This film is about a young probable hockey player, Ajit Singh, who gets trapped in a tragic situation during the dark days of Punjab. [ 1 ]

    Souten: The Other Woman is a 2006 Bollywood film written and directed by Karan Razdan, starring Gulshan Grover, Mahima Chaudhry, Vikram Singh, Kiran Rathod and Shakti Kapoor. The film was released on 24 March 2006. [1] [2] [3] [4]

    3 Deewarein (transl. 3 Walls) is a 2003 Indian Hindi-language crime film written, directed, and co-starred by Nagesh Kukunoor. Juhi Chawla, Jackie Shroff, Naseeruddin Shah, Gulshan Grover, and Sujata Mehta form the rest of the cast.
